要导出Excel表的字段以及字段类型,可以使用openpyxl模块来读取Excel文件,并使用其中的workbook和worksheet类来操作表格数据。
首先,安装openpyxl模块:
pip install openpyxl
然后,可以使用以下代码来导出Excel表的字段以及字段类型:
import openpyxl
# 打开Excel文件
workbook = openpyxl.load_workbook('filename.xlsx')
# 选择第一个表
worksheet = workbook.worksheets[0]
# 获取表的字段名
field_names = []
for cell in worksheet.iter_cols(min_row=1, max_row=1, values_only=True):
field_names = cell
# 获取表的字段类型
field_types = []
for cell in worksheet.iter_cols(min_row=2, max_row=2, values_only=True):
field_types = cell
# 打印字段名和字段类型
for field_name, field_type in zip(field_names, field_types):
print(f'字段名:{field_name} 字段类型:{field_type}')
# 关闭Excel文件
workbook.close()
请将filename.xlsx
替换为实际的Excel文件名。这段代码会打印每个字段的字段名和字段类型。